Worksheet Description

The Commands worksheet features a series of speech bubbles linked to various cartoon characters, inviting students to write a command for each character to say. The layout implies that each character might issue a different command based on their appearance or presumed personality. There are no pre-written prompts or scenarios, leaving the student to use their imagination to create an appropriate command for each character.

The worksheet is teaching students to think creatively about how commands can vary depending on the speaker. By asking students to fill in the speech bubbles, it reinforces the concept of how imperative sentences are formed and used in direct speech. This task allows students to practice writing commands in a way that might reflect the character’s voice, thereby enhancing their understanding of dialogue and character-driven communication. It also encourages them to engage with the idea that context and speaker identity can influence the language and style of a command.
